Day 219: May 5, 2025 – Chiapas, Mexico
We crossed the border from Guatemala into Mexico just in time for Cinco de Mayo. A group of colorful schoolchildren dancers welcomed us at the port.




The town of Chiapas itself did not have much going on, but the port facility was excellent: very green, spotless, and included a swimming pool just for us cruisers (not open to the public).
